On today’s episode of WHAT THE TRUCK?!? Dooner and The Dude are talking about the massive shift in imports from the West Coast to the East Coast. We’ll find out from Ed McCarthy, chief operating officer at the Georgia Ports Authority, how the port prepared for the incoming swell — and is it here to stay? Truckers for Troops’ 16th annual campaign launched this week and Norita Taylor, director of public relations at the Owner-Operator Independent Drivers Association, is here to tell us all about it. The fundraising effort has been an OOIDA tradition since 2007, dedicated to sending care packages to service personnel stationed in combat zones. Highway aims to bring digital carrier identity to the supply chain. We’ll hear from its founder, Jordan Graft, on why he started the company his next FreightTech venture. Are truckers being used as political pawns? FreightWaves Editorial Director Rachel Premack talks about how the “driver shortage” myth is being used against drivers. Back The Truck Up’s Rooster and SuperTrucker are back from F3 to talk about our ride in a Plus AI autonomous truck; the world’s scariest truck thief; UPS failing the SATs; answering kids’ questions on trucking; and a touch-a-truck comes to Chattanooga, Tennessee.
